Data processing: database and file management or data structures – Database design – Data structure types
Reexamination Certificate
2005-05-17
2005-05-17
Jung, David (Department: 2134)
Data processing: database and file management or data structures
Database design
Data structure types
C707S793000, C707S793000, C707S793000
Reexamination Certificate
active
06895401
ABSTRACT:
A method and apparatus of performing active update notification. Components of an application are able to specify interest in a data object or set of data objects by registering an interest object with an update management component of the application. The interest object specifies the interested application component, as well as the identity of one or more data objects or an attribute value or range of values to associate with data objects. When modifications are made to data objects corresponding to the registered interest objects, the interested application component or components receive an update notification from the update management component. In one embodiment, active update notification is performed within a multi-tier application. An update management component exists at the application server on the application tier, as well as at each client in the client tier. In the application tier, the update management component maintains, with respect to clients and servers, a registry of interest objects of sufficient depth to determine which clients or other servers may be interested in changes to data objects. Update notifications are then sent only to the interested clients or servers. The interest registry of the update management component in the interested client is used to resolve the interested application component, and to forward the update notification appropriately.
REFERENCES:
patent: 5109486 (1992-04-01), Seymour
patent: 5560022 (1996-09-01), Dunstan et al.
patent: 5758074 (1998-05-01), Marlin et al.
patent: 5778179 (1998-07-01), Kanai et al.
patent: 5917912 (1999-06-01), Ginter et al.
patent: 5925100 (1999-07-01), Drewry et al.
patent: 5950006 (1999-09-01), Crater et al.
patent: 5983351 (1999-11-01), Glogau
patent: 5987497 (1999-11-01), Allgeier
patent: 5987514 (1999-11-01), Rangarajan
patent: 5995972 (1999-11-01), Allgeier
patent: 6021437 (2000-02-01), Chen et al.
patent: 6044381 (2000-03-01), Boothby et al.
patent: 6059838 (2000-05-01), Fraley et al.
patent: 6173327 (2001-01-01), DeBorst et al.
patent: 6243716 (2001-06-01), Waldo et al.
patent: 6385643 (2002-05-01), Jacobs et al.
Pietzuch et al., Composite event detection as a generic middleware extension, Network, IEEE vol. 18, Issue 1, Jan.-Feb. 2004, pp. 44-55.*
Marchetti et al., Enabling data quality notification in cooperative information systems through a Web-service based architecture, Web Information Systems Engineering, 2003, Proceedings of the Fourth International Conference on, Dec. 10-12, 2003, pp. 32.*
Busby et al., Enhancing NWS for use in an SNMP managed internetwork, Parallel and Distributed Processing Symposium, 2000, Proceedings, 14thInternational, May 1-5, 2000,. pp. 506-511.*
http://developer.java.sun.com/servlet./Pr . . . IArticles/Programming/KeepObjectsInSync/, by Jim Coker, Feb., 1997.
Sun Microsystems, 1997, “Java RMI Tutorial,” Revision 1.3, JDK 1.1, FCS, Feb. 10, 1997.
Ho et al., “An extended CORBA event service with support for load balancing and fault-tolerance,” Distributed Objects and Applications, 2000, Proceedings, DOA '00 International Symposium on, pp. 49-58.
Mouaddib et al., “A semi-structured object model with relations,” Database Conference, 2000, ADC 2000, Proceedings 11thAustralasian, 1999, pp. 99-106.
Henning, “SPEC CPU2000: measuring CPU performance in the New Millennium,” Computer, vol. 33, Issue 7, Jul. 2000, pp. 28-35.
McDonnell Kevin
McDonnell Vanessa
Skinner Brian
Turk Andy Kittridge
Jung David
Sun Microsystems Inc.
LandOfFree
Method and apparatus of performing active update notification does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Method and apparatus of performing active update notification,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Method and apparatus of performing active update notification will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-3368620